Understanding Bookmarking Basics
Before diving into strategies, it's essential to understand the basic types of bookmarks:
- Standard Bookmarks: These are typical links saved to your browser for easy access.
- Social Bookmarks: These allow users to save links on social bookmarking sites and share them with others.
- Folder Bookmarks: Organizing bookmarks into folders helps categorize and simplify access.
Developing Your Bookmarking Strategy
To create an effective bookmarking strategy, consider the following steps:
- Define Categories: Identify themes or categories relevant to your interests and work, such as 'Research,' 'News,' and 'Personal.'
- Create a Consistent Naming Convention: Use clear and consistent naming for all bookmarks to make them easy to find.
- Utilize Tags: Tags help further refine your bookmarks, allowing you to filter links based on specific keywords.
Utilizing Bookmark Management Tools
Incorporating bookmark management tools can elevate your strategies:
- Browser Extensions: Extensions like Bookmark Manager and Evernote Web Clipper enhance traditional bookmarking capabilities.
- Cross-Device Syncing: Ensure that your bookmarks are synced across devices, allowing for easy access from anywhere.
- Collaboration Features: Some tools allow sharing of bookmarks with others, which can be beneficial for group projects or research.
